Motor Vehicles

The motor is the main component of the treadmill. It is responsible for the conversion of electrical energy into movement that moves the belt. It also controls the speed and the incline. Understanding the motor will assist you in understanding the requirements of a treadmill and ensure that it is able to help you achieve your fitness goals.

A treadmill motor works differently based on its size and the voltage. The larger the motor is, the more powerful and faster it can run. The motor has to work harder to overcome your stride resistance when you walk, run, or run.

The motor of a treadmill does not necessarily last longer because it has a higher rating. The lifespan of a motor is influenced by a variety of factors, such as the quality of the motor, its usage, and its maintenance schedule.

The warranty of the manufacturer also provides information about the treadmill's endurance and motor reliability. Warranty periods under five years are typically indicative of a treadmill that is not performing to its best and won't last long. Warranty terms ranging between 10 and lifetime feature premium quality and longevity.

Deck

The treadmill's deck is the surface that your feet will land on when you run or walk. A good deck should be sturdy enough to hold your body weight without bending or breaking. The deck must be lubricated and smooth to stop the belt from slipping when you use it. The majority of manufacturers offer a deck warranty and maintenance kit. Some decks may need to be flipped over and lubricated periodically.

A deck of high-quality should be at least 20 inches wide to accommodate your feet. A deck that is narrow can be uncomfortable for runners with long strides. It's important to make sure that the belt is centered properly on the deck. It's not common for treadmill walking belts to move from side to side in the course of. This can cause the belt to slide across the deck rails and make it difficult to maintain the same pace. Many treadmill companies offer simple-to-follow videos to help you center your belt.

The majority of treadmills with an incline feature an extended deck than non-incline machines, which is helpful for taller users.
